Background was, I think, stamping with Brushos using an IO backgrounder. I sponged a bit of blue ink over the whiter areas. Stamped the barnacles, embossed with white EP. Stamped the seaweed in Versafine Olympia Green. Added Lavinia Moon Dust glitter (Sea Breeze, what else!) to parts of the seaweed, and Stickles to the barnacles. I stamped a Prickle from Art Journey in dusty concord, it made me think of sea urchins. The coral border is from Joanna Sheen, cut from watercolour paper and coloured with watercolours. A Hello stamped on vellum and cut with the SU word bubbles helped fill a blank space. The fish is from Pink Cat Studios, stamped on watercolour paper, embossed and then coloured with Twinkling H2Os and some white gel pen dots. I cut a frame from gold card and popped it up on foam after embossing with the SU Subtle ef.
There are actually some Prills along the bottom of the coral border, but they got covered up by the frame :-(.
